- The distance between Porto-Alegre, Brazil and New Orleans, Louisiana, Usa is approximately 7,848 km or 4,877 mi.
- To reach Porto-Alegre in this distance one would set out from New Orleans, Louisiana bearing 144.7°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Porto-Alegre bearing 144.7° or SE .
- Both have a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Both are in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 0.5 °C (0.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.6 °C (11.9°F) less in Porto-Alegre.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 224.4 mm (8.8 in) less which is equivalent to 224.4 l/m² (5.51 US gal/ft²) or 2,244,000 l/ha (239,898 US gal/ac) less. About 6/7 as much.
- There are 192 fewer hours of sunlight per year in Porto-Alegre. In whichever way circa 0h 31' less per day or about 1 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.8° lower in Porto-Alegre than in New Orleans, Louisiana.
- Relative humidity levels are 14.9%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 2.8°C (5.1°F) higher.
